Output 15421458f3019d666fac7cc685d193e7008563a5baea4dddcd779e14a54a6e0d:0

value
143524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4511472d4278171cdd1902cb431899bc597697d7 OP_EQUAL
address
37zDFH8ZUtdKL9FQjL3N5aDyaAwPiyvJS4
transaction
15421458f3019d666fac7cc685d193e7008563a5baea4dddcd779e14a54a6e0d
spent
true